We propose a mean-field Bak-Sneppen (MFBS) model with varying interaction strength. The interaction strength, here denoted by alpha, specifies the degree of interaction, and varies smoothly between 0 for no interaction and 1 for full interaction (restoring the original BS model). Our simulations of the MFBS model reveal some interesting features. When beta is non-zero, the MFBS model can evolve to a self-organized critical (SOC) state. The critical exponent of the avalanche size distribution, tau, is insensitive to changes in alpha. The critical exponent of average avalanche size, gamma, and the avalanche dimension exponent, D, both increase slightly with alpha < 0.5 but remain constant if alpha > 0.5.
